In 3D Zelda games, do you

Hold (Default) - This form of targeting requires you hold down the targeting button to focus on one enemy. Letting go causes you to stop targeting the enemy.

or do you set it to

Toggle - This setting only requires you press the targeting button once, and another time to stop targeting. However, if there are other enemies nearby, pressing it again will cause you to target the nearby enemies.

There is also the option to not Z-Target at all...
